In today’s fast-paced and diverse world, companies are constantly looking for ways to create a more inclusive and accommodating work environment for their employees. One way that companies are meeting the needs of their workers is by providing a designated prayer room in the workplace. This small, quiet space is a place where employees can pause, reflect, and practice their faith during the workday. The benefits of having a prayer room in the workplace are numerous, and companies that offer this amenity are finding that it can lead to a more positive and productive work environment.
One of the main benefits of having a prayer room in the workplace is that it allows employees to practice their faith in a comfortable and welcoming environment. Many employees may not feel comfortable openly practicing their religion in front of their coworkers, and having a designated prayer room provides a private and sacred space for individuals to do so. This can help employees feel more supported and valued by their employer, leading to increased job satisfaction and loyalty.
Another benefit of having a prayer room in the workplace is that it can help employees manage stress and improve their overall well-being. Taking a few moments out of a busy workday to pray or meditate can help employees recharge and refocus, leading to increased concentration and productivity. Research has shown that regular prayer or meditation can reduce stress, lower blood pressure, and improve mental health, all of which can have a positive impact on an employee’s performance at work.
Having a prayer room in the workplace can also promote a sense of community and inclusivity among employees. When companies provide a space for employees to practice their faith, it sends a message that all employees are valued and respected, regardless of their religious beliefs. This can help foster a more positive and harmonious work environment, where employees feel comfortable expressing their beliefs and engaging with coworkers from different backgrounds.
Furthermore, having a prayer room in the workplace can help companies attract and retain top talent. In today’s competitive job market, employees are looking for employers who offer not only competitive salaries and benefits, but also a supportive and inclusive work environment. Companies that provide amenities like a prayer room can set themselves apart from their competitors and demonstrate their commitment to valuing the diverse needs of their employees.
In addition to these benefits, having a prayer room in the workplace can also help companies comply with anti-discrimination laws and promote diversity and inclusion in the workplace. By providing a space for employees to practice their faith, companies can ensure that all employees feel welcome and respected, regardless of their religious beliefs. This can help create a more inclusive work environment where employees feel comfortable bringing their whole selves to work, leading to increased collaboration and creativity.
